The 3764 postcode, which includes Kilmore, Forbes, Glenaroua, High Camp, Kilmore East, Moranding, Tantaraboo and Willowmavin, has 4,089 households. Of these, 1,630 homes — or 39.9% — have installed rooftop solar panels, reflecting the community's growing move toward renewable energy. According to daily average sunshine data from the nearest weather station at Kilmore Assumption College, households in this community receive approximately 4.4 kWh of sunlight per day. Across 3764, rooftop solar systems collectively generate approximately 13,769,000 kWh of clean energy each year, based on an average system size of 6.1 kW. At current electricity rates, that's equivalent to around $4,130,700 of clean energy at grid electricity costs annually.
Solar Battery energy storage is growing just as rapidly, with 30 battery systems now installed across 3764. Together, these systems provide 380 kWh of stored energy capacity, with the average household storing around 12.7 kWh. This means local solar households can typically power their homes for 5.1 hours each night using clean energy they generated themselves during the day.

When it comes to system choices, top brands like Tesla (13.5 kWh), Alpha ESS (7.8 kWh), and Sungrow (9.6 kWh) are popular for their reliability and performance, offering options for households of all sizes. Average annual bill savings for Kilmore homes with solar batteries might look like:
• 5–7 kWh system: $1,300–$1,700 saved per year • 10–13 kWh system: $1,800–$2,400 saved per year • 13.5 kWh+ system: $2,300–$2,700 saved per year

Interest in battery storage is also being fuelled by generous incentives. The Australian Federal Government offers a solar batteries rebate VIC residents can access, providing up to 30% off the cost of a battery. For a 11.5–13.5 kWh system, this can mean $3,400–$4,000 off your installation price—a real game-changer that could halve your payback period to just 3–4 years. Plus, by joining a Virtual Power Plant (VPP), Kilmore locals can share excess energy with the grid and earn bill credits, adding resilience and boosting long-term savings.
